What Are Remote Jobs Working for Podcasts?

Remote podcast jobs focus on the preparation and production of programming for podcasts. You may work from home to create ideas for shows, host the podcast, transcribe interview recordings, or help produce and record the podcast. As a producer or content creator, you develop the programming and may act as a host or hire on-air talent. As a technician or engineer, you record the podcast and edit the audio using software such as Adobe Audition, Logic Pro, and Audacity before publishing it. Other remote roles include being an editing intern and a remote production assistant.

What is a remote podcast?

A remote podcast is a podcast that is recorded with hosts, guests, or participants located in different physical locations, often connecting via the internet. This setup allows for greater flexibility, enabling people to collaborate from anywhere in the world without the need to be in the same room or studio. Remote podcasting typically uses tools like Zoom, Riverside.fm, or SquadCast to record high-quality audio and video. It has become increasingly popular as it allows for broader guest access and easier scheduling.

What are some common challenges faced by remote podcast producers, and how can they be addressed?

Remote podcast producers often encounter challenges such as coordinating schedules across different time zones, maintaining high audio quality with remote guests, and ensuring effective communication among distributed team members. These challenges can be addressed by using reliable scheduling tools, providing clear technical guidelines to guests, and utilizing collaboration platforms for seamless teamwork. Establishing clear workflows and regular check-ins also helps keep projects on track and fosters a cohesive production environment, even when working remotely.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Podcast Producer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Podcast Producer, you need expertise in audio editing, sound design, and storytelling, often backed by experience in media production or communications. Familiarity with audio editing software like Adobe Audition or Audacity, and knowledge of remote recording platforms, are typically required. Strong organizational skills, creativity, and effective communication help in coordinating guests, managing schedules, and crafting engaging content. These abilities ensure high-quality production, efficient workflows, and compelling episodes that grow and maintain a dedicated audience.
